Dual 2-input CMOS AND Gate IC, designed for surface mounting with a VSSOP package. Features a 1.2V to 3.6V supply voltage range, 2.8ns propagation delay at nominal supply, and a maximum operating temperature of 85°C. This logic IC offers 2 functions, each with 2 inputs, and a low load capacitance of 30pF. RoHS compliant and moisture sensitive level 1.
